Laboratory Waste Categories
Comprehensive management for all types of laboratory-generated waste materials

Chemical Waste
Expired reagents, reaction byproducts, contaminated solvents, and unused chemicals requiring proper identification, segregation, and disposal through licensed treatment facilities.

Biological Waste
Cultures, specimens, contaminated materials, and biological research waste requiring sterilization, inactivation, and specialized disposal methods.

Radioactive Materials
Low-level radioactive waste from research applications requiring decay storage, documentation, and disposal through authorized radioactive waste facilities.

Contaminated Equipment
Laboratory glassware, instruments, personal protective equipment, and other materials contaminated with chemicals or biological agents.
